What is the difference between Community Service Assistant vs Social Worker?

AspectCommunity Service AssistantSocial Worker
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require certificationBachelor's degree in social work or related field; licensure often required
Work EnvironmentCommunity centers, healthcare facilities, schoolsHospitals, clinics, government agencies, community organizations
Employer & Industry UsageNonprofits, government programs, healthcare providersPublic and private social service agencies, healthcare institutions
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level roles assisting community servicesSeeking professional social work careers and qualifications

Community Service Assistants typically support community programs with basic administrative and support tasks, often requiring minimal formal education. Social Workers have advanced degrees and provide direct counseling, case management, and advocacy. While both roles serve community needs, Social Workers generally have more responsibilities and require specialized credentials. The two roles are related but differ significantly in education, scope, and responsibilities.

How you'll make an impact

As a Customer Service Assistant, you'll be the first point of contact for customers and play a key role in office operations and the overall customer experience. With your strong organization skills, you'll keep accurate documentation, maintain office systems, and support the effective daily functioning of the district or field office.

You'll work closely with Relationship Managers, Customer Service Managers, and district staff to deliver outstanding service and keep office operations running smoothly.

If you love building relationships, solving problems, and delivering excellent service, this could be the role for you.


What you'll do

  • Provide friendly, professional customer service by greeting visitors, handling reception, and responding to inquiries in person and by phone
  • Manage office and administrative tasks, including preparing documentation and correspondence, maintaining filing systems, and updating customer records
  • Process mail, payments, and daily banking, ensuring accuracy and timely handling of customer transactions
  • Coordinate office operations by ordering supplies, generating reports and supporting district events
  • Proactively coordinate office needs to resolve issues before they impact operations

What you'll bring to the team

Required qualifications:

  • A certificate in office administration or at least one year of related experience (or an equivalent combination of education and experience)
  • General knowledge of administrative processes
  • Working knowledge of common software applications, including Microsoft 365, and comfort with computer-based tasks

Preferred qualifications:

  • Customer service experience, ideally in a financial, law, agricultural or advisory setting
  • Bilingualism (English and French) is an asset
